How do I format a floating number to a fixed width with the following requirements:
- Leading zero if n < 1
- Add trailing decimal zero(s) to fill up fixed width
- Truncate decimal digits past fixed width
- Align all decimal points
For example:
% formatter something like '{:06}'
numbers = [23.23, 0.123334987, 1, 4.223, 9887.2]
for number in numbers:
    print formatter.format(number)
The output would be like
  23.2300
   0.1233
   1.0000
   4.2230
9887.2000
